The anesthetic gas scavenging system removes anesthetic gas mixtures in areas fitted with nitrous oxide terminal units, such as operating rooms.

Anesthesia gas scavenging systems help remove waste anesthetic gases from the patient's breathing circuit during surgeries. These systems play a vital role in ensuring minimum environmental pollution and safety of healthcare workers by eliminating traces of inhalational anesthetic gases in the operating room atmosphere.
